1 Virtual Desktop Infrastructure Een alternatief SBC concept? Jacco Bezemer2 Wat ga ik behandelen? Wat is VDI? Voordelen van SBC? VDI versus SBC De vo...
Virtual Desktop Infrastructure Een alternatief SBC concept? Jacco Bezemer
Wat ga ik behandelen? • • • • • • • • • • •
Wat is VDI? Voordelen van SBC? VDI versus SBC De voor- en nadelen van VDI De techniek De componenten Use-cases Aandachtspunten Producten Toekomstige ontwikkelingen Samenvatting
Wat is VDI
• Een centrale infrastructuur die via een display protocol desktops presenteert aan eindgebruikers • Waar kennen we dit van…
Server Based Computing (TS, Citrix)
Traditioneel SBC model
VDI model
Wat is er anders?
SBC = shared remote desktop
VDI = dedicated (personnel) remote desktop
Voordelen SBC • Wat zijn de voordelen van SBC (Terminal Services) – – – –
Centraal beheer Goede performance over een langzame verbinding Overal toegang Goede beveiliging
VDI versus SBC VDI
SBC
• • • • • •
• • • •
Betere gebruikerservaring Applicatiecompatibiliteit Eenvoudigere beveiliging Hoog beschikbaar Betere capaciteitsverdeling Desktop verplaatsbaar naar andere host • Suspend/resume • Desktop op zak • Concurrentie
Veel install-base Veel kennis in de markt Bewezen techniek Hogere gebruikersdichtheid (gemeten in Euro’s)
En de nadelen? • Elke virtuele desktop vereist een niet OEM Windows licentie • CPU intensieve (en multimediarijke) toepassingen • Randapparatuur • Offline betekent geen of minder functionaliteit • Meer server hardware nodig • Vereist een SAN • Kosten
VDI versus Server virtualisatie • • • • •
Niet altijd online zoals servers Eenvoudigere toegankelijkheid Geen één op één relatie USB apparaten en printers In grotere getale aanwezig
De techniek • Centrale spil is de VDI Connection Broker – Authenticeert en autoriseert gebruikers – Presenteert beschikbare virtuele machines – Regelt powermanagement van de desktop – Verbindt de gebruiker met de virtuele desktop – Integreert client hardware met VM (printers, USB) – Centraal beheer van gebruikers en VMs (desktop)
De componenten • • • • •
Thin-client of PC Connection Broker Gevirtualiseerde desktop Virtuele Infrastructuur Desktop Management Suite
Optionele RSA Authentication server
Internet
ESX Server Telewerkers
DMZ
View Security Server
LAN
View Connection Server
Desktop pools Pool A
Pool B
VirtualCenter server
Gebruikerscontrole
Use-cases • Wanneer applicaties niet functioneren in traditionele SBC omgeving • Remote toegang naar de desktop omgeving • Minimale hardware op de werkplek (thin-client) en persoonlijke desktop ervaring is noodzakelijk • Snelle uitrol van desktops noodzakelijk • Standaard werkplek voor verschillende hardware • Desktop roaming • Energiebesparing
Aandachtspunten • Nog steeds de traditionele uitdagingen: – Beheren VM’s (updates, antivirus) – Goed image (template) is belangrijk – Desktop beheer (VDI voorziet alleen in VM beheer) – Applicatie beheer – SAN – Hoe offline werken
Productkeuze • Inmiddels diverse producten • Er zijn nog geen winnaars • Keuze hangt af van – functionaliteit (use-case) – In gebruik hebbende technieken • Ervaringen van collega bedrijven/instellingen • Bevindingen van Proof of Concept periode
Sizing VDI omgeving • Hangt erg af van het gebruik • Op basis van case studies en PoC – gemiddeld genomen 7 Windows XP Professional VM’s per CPU core • Een dual quad core machine met 24GB geheugen kan ongeveer 40~45 Windows XP Pro VM’s met 512MB actief hebben
Toekomst • • • • • • • • •
Gebruikersdichtheid neemt toe (gemeten in Euro’s) Remote Display Protocol verbeteringen Thin provisioning Offline VDI / Bare Metal Hypervior Streamed and hosted Applicatie Virtualisatie en OS streaming Desktop on-demand samenstellen Desktop as a service Ter ondersteuning van BYOPC
Samenvatting • Toepasbaarheid van VDI hangt af van de “use case” • In de praktijk vaak complementair aan traditionele SBC en desktop omgeving • Niet de traditionele uitdagingen uit het oog verliezen • VDI is nieuw, en nog niemand heeft alle antwoorden • Uitdagingen dicteren een Proof of Concept periode • VDI heeft toekomst